What does a utility service body actually need repaired?
Compartments, first and consistently. A utility or telecom body carries expensive test equipment, connectors and material in compartments that are opened dozens of times a day and rained on for years, and the failure is almost never the latch. It is the hinge mounting sagging the door out of its seal, the seal itself hardening, and the compartment floor going soft where water has been sitting.
The repair sequence matters. Correcting the door opening and the hinge mounting before replacing a seal is what makes the seal last, because a new gasket on a sagged door flattens on one side within a season. Compartment floors get cut out and replaced in sections with the structure underneath treated, since patching over a soft floor traps the water that caused it.
Shelving and dividers inside the compartment are worth revisiting at the same time. Utility crews reorganize what they carry as network and distribution work changes, and a body laid out for one generation of equipment is usually holding the next one badly. While the compartment is open, changing the divider layout costs very little and the crew stops fighting the truck.
- Door openings and hinge mounting corrected before seals are replaced
- Compartment floors replaced in sections with structure treated underneath
- Drain paths opened so compartments shed water instead of holding it
- Divider and shelf layouts updated while the compartment is open
- Latch and lock alignment set after the door hangs correctly
OPS-02
How is aerial and boom equipment mounting structure handled?
As a fatigue problem, because that is what it is. An aerial device puts a reversing bending load into its mounting every time it is deployed, and that load travels into the subframe and the frame rail rather than staying at the pedestal. Cracks show up at weld toes and at the edges of mounting plates with no impact anywhere in the unit history.
The repair changes the load path rather than restoring it. Cracks are mapped in full instead of at the visible portion, cut back to sound material, rewelded with the correct process for the parent metal, then gusseted or given a larger footprint so the new weld is not carrying exactly what the old one failed under. Subframe attachment and outrigger pad mounting get checked in the same pass.
The equipment boundary is stated in the estimate. This shop repairs the mounting structure, the subframe, the body and the frame rail attachment. The aerial device itself, its hydraulic system and its periodic certification go to the equipment manufacturer or a specialist for that brand. Any dielectric testing after work near an insulated boom section is that specialist responsibility, not this one, and the estimate says so.
OPS-03
Why is high visibility marking specified so precisely?
Because these units park in live traffic for extended periods and the marking is the only thing separating a crew from moving vehicles. Utility and telecom operators specify chevron patterns, reflective striping, conspicuity marking and beacon placement to a standard, and units that come back from a vendor with a stripe two inches off do not match the rest of the fleet they park alongside.
The existing layout is measured and photographed before teardown for exactly that reason. Positions, sizes, colors and material types are recorded so the reproduction matches rather than approximates, and any operator specification document is worked from directly. On Santa Ana arterials where these crews work shoulder positions daily, that consistency is an operational requirement rather than a preference.
Timing is the part that gets rushed. Reflective material and vinyl bond only to fully cured finish, so a repainted panel waits before its marking goes back. Applied to fresh paint, reflective striping lifts at the edges within months and the unit is back for the same work. Warning and work lighting is reinstalled to the recorded positions with connections and grounds cleaned and reterminated.
- Chevron and conspicuity layouts measured and photographed before teardown
- Operator marking specifications worked from directly where they exist
- Reflective material applied only to fully cured finish
- Beacon and work lighting returned to recorded positions
- Ground points cleaned to bare metal and reterminated during reinstall
OPS-04
How are units scheduled when they are committed to a job for weeks?
Around the assignment calendar, agreed in advance. A utility or telecom unit assigned to a distribution rebuild or a network build is holding a crew, so pulling it unexpectedly is expensive in a way that a spare van is not. Fleet coordinators know weeks ahead when a job closes out, and that window is where body work belongs.
Scope categories make that planning possible. Compartment door and seal work, rack and light installs and light body repair generally clear in two to four business days. Compartment floor replacement, body mounting restoration and aerial mount reinforcement run four to eight. Full refinish or a body transfer to a new chassis is a one to three week commitment and should be scheduled as one.

Compartment doors on our service bodies stopped sealing. Is that a gasket problem?
Usually not on its own. The door has sagged out of its opening because the hinge mounting has fatigued, so a new gasket flattens on one side within a season. The opening and hinge mounting are corrected first, then the seal is replaced and the latch and lock alignment is set after the door hangs correctly. Compartment drains get cleared in the same pass.
We have cracking around an aerial device mount. What causes it without an accident?
Fatigue. An aerial device puts a reversing bending load into its mounting every deployment, and that load travels into the subframe and frame rail. Weld toes and mounting plate edges crack over time with no impact history at all. The crack is mapped fully, cut back to sound material, rewelded, then gusseted so the load distributes into different structure.
Do you work on the aerial device or its hydraulics?
No. Scope here is the mounting structure, the subframe, the body and the frame rail attachment. The aerial device, its hydraulic system, its periodic certification and any dielectric testing go to the equipment manufacturer or a specialist for that brand. The estimate identifies which side of that line each item falls on rather than leaving it ambiguous.
Can you reproduce our chevron and conspicuity marking exactly?
Yes. Positions, sizes, colors and material types are measured and photographed before teardown, and any operator marking specification is worked from directly. Reflective material bonds only to fully cured finish, so on repainted panels marking is scheduled after the paint has gassed out. Applied to fresh finish, reflective striping lifts at the edges within months.
Our compartment floors are going soft. Can they be patched?
Patching over a soft floor traps the water that softened it and the area fails again larger. The affected sections are cut out, the structure underneath is treated, new material goes in, and the interior gets a coating that tolerates standing water and dropped equipment. Compartment drain paths are opened at the same time so water leaves instead of collecting.
